<br />ARTICLE VII <br />MORTGAGE FINANCING <br /> <br />Section 7.1. Mortgage Financing. <br /> <br />(a) On or before the closing date, the Developer shall submit, to the City, evidence of <br />one or more commitments for mortgage financing which, together with committed equity for such <br />construction, is sufficient for the construction of the Minimum Improvements. Such commitments <br />may be submitted as short term financing, long term mortgage financing, a bridge loan with a long <br />term take-out financing commitment, or any combination of the acceptable financing instrument. <br />Such commitment or commitments for short term or long term mortgage financing shall be subject <br />only to such conditions as are normal and customary in the mortgage banking industry. <br /> <br />(b) If the City finds that the mortgage financing is sufficiently committed and adequate <br />in amount to provide for the construction of the Minimum Improvements, then the City shall notify <br />the Developer, in writing, of its approval. Such approval shall not be unreasonably withheld and <br />either approval or rejection shall be given within 10 days from the date when the City is provided <br />the evidence of mortgage financing. A failure by the City to respond to such evidence of mortgage <br />financing shall be deemed to constitute an approval hereunder. If the City rejects the evidence of <br />mortgage financing as inadequate, it shall do so, in writing, specifying the basis for the rejection. <br />In any event, the Developer shall submit adequate evidence of mortgage fmancing within 30 days <br />after such rejection. <br /> <br />Section 7.2. City's Option to Cure Default on Mortgage. In the event that there occurs a <br />default under any Mortgage authorized pursuant to Article VII of this Agreement, the Developers <br />shall cause the City to receive copies of any notice of default received by any developers from the <br />holder of such Mortgage. Thereafter, the City shall have the right, but not the obligation, to cure <br />any such default on behalf of the Developer within such cure periods as are available to the <br />Developer under the Mortgage documents. <br /> <br />Page 16 <br />
